Reaction of dimethylsulfoxonium methylide with a β-silylmethylene malonate gives diversified products, cyclopropane, cyclobutane or allyl and homoallyl silanes depending upon the stoichiometry of the reactants and reaction conditions. Contrary to this, reaction of a β-arylmethylene malonate gives only the cyclopropane product. The product(s) formed are unique and the silicon group played a crucial role either by assisting and/or by participating in the process.
Conditions have been established for the reaction of dimethylsulfoxonium methylide with a β-silylmethylene malonate to give a cyclopropane or a cyclobutane or an allylsilane with high selectivity.
